Robert Pattinson and Suki Waterhouse’s Relationship Timeline: Every Chapter of Their Love Story

Robert Pattinson and Suki Waterhouse have spent most of their relationship fiercely guarding it, and yet somehow the public has watched nearly every chapter unfold anyway. A kiss caught outside a cinema in 2018 turned into a private, low-key partnership that lasted years before either of them said much about it out loud, engagement rumors, a baby, a rare red carpet appearance, and a running joke about “Daddy Batman.” Whether they’re actually married at this point remains one of the few things the two have managed to keep entirely to themselves.

Below, we trace their story from that first blurry photo in London to the family they’ve quietly built since.

July 2018: First Sighting

Robert and Suki were first linked on July 30, when E! obtained photos of the two kissing on a London street. 

August 2018: "Casually Dating"

A source told E! the couple was keeping things casual. Pattinson had only recently come out of a three-year relationship, and, per the insider, “he isn’t looking for anything serious right now.”

January 2019: Birthdays and Hand-Holding

Waterhouse and Pattinson celebrated her 27th birthday together, photographed leaving her party that night. A couple of weeks later, People caught the two holding hands after a run through London.

April 2019: Robert Acknowledges the Relationship, Reluctantly

Asked about Waterhouse by The Sunday Times, Pattinson’s first response was, “Do I have to?” He went on to explain his resistance to discussing his personal life at all. “If you let people in, it devalues what love is,” he said. “If a stranger on the street asked you about your relationship, you’d think it extremely rude. If you put up a wall, it ends up better.” It marked the first time he’d referenced Waterhouse publicly at all.

September 2019: Ibiza

Photographer Sofia Malamute shared a photo of the couple cuddled together in early September, captioned simply, “Ibiza, 2019.”

January 2020: Engagement Rumors Begin

Waterhouse was spotted wearing a gold band during a Dior dinner party in Paris, immediately sparking engagement speculation. Neither she nor Pattinson confirmed or denied it.

May 2020: Quarantining Together

Pattinson all but confirmed he was isolating with Waterhouse in a GQ June cover story, revealing he’d been sequestered “with his girlfriend” in the London apartment rented for him during a pause in Batman production.

April 2021: A Photo in the Background

Waterhouse posted a selfie on April 15, and sharp-eyed fans quickly spotted a photo of her kissing Pattinson visible behind her.

February 2022: Opening Up During the Batman Press Tour

Pattinson gave two rare glimpses into life with Waterhouse. In GQ, he explained why he’d changed the location of the interview from the London Zoo to Holland Park. “I was talking to my girlfriend last night and she was like, ‘You know, people don’t really like zoos.’

On Jimmy Kimmel Live!, he described watching The Batman for the first time with her and how her reaction changed his own feelings about the film. “I’m pretty sure she’s not normally into watching superhero movies,” he said. “And just seeing that it was capturing her attention the entire time, and then she held my hand and touched it to her face and I could feel a little tear. And I was like, ‘No way!'”

December 2022: The Red Carpet Debut

Four years into the relationship, the couple finally walked a red carpet together, attending the Dior Fall 2023 menswear show in Giza, Egypt, that December, giggling and flirting the whole time.

February 2023: Opening Up in The Times

Waterhouse spoke more candidly than ever in a profile with The Times, revealing that she and Pattinson live together in London and rarely spend long apart. “I’m shocked that I’m so happy with someone for nearly five years,” she said, adding that the spark hasn’t faded. “I’m always incredibly excited when I see his name pop up on my phone or even a text, and I think he feels the same about me. We’ve always got so much to say, and I find him hilarious.”

May 2023: The Met Gala Debut

The couple posed together on the red carpet at the Met Gala for the first time.

December 2023: Engagement Rumors & Pregnancy

Waterhouse was photographed wearing a toi et moi diamond ring on her left hand, reigniting engagement speculation. Around the same time, she began sharing photos revealing her pregnancy, including a series of vacation shots showing off her growing belly.

April 2024: Welcome to the World

Waterhouse shared the first photo of her and Pattinson’s baby on Instagram, keeping details like the baby’s name and sex private. “Welcome to the world angel,” she wrote.

June 2024: Opening Up About Fatherhood

At the Dior Homme Menswear show in Paris, Pattinson spoke publicly about fatherhood for the first time. “It makes you feel very old and very young,” he said. “She’s so cute. And you know, I’m amazed by how quickly their personality comes. So even at three months, I’m like, ‘Oh, I can kinda see who she is already.'” He mentioned he’d only planned to stay in Paris one day before heading home to his family.

July 2024: How They Actually Met

In a British Vogue cover story, Waterhouse revealed that she and Pattinson had actually met six years earlier at a games night in L.A., “one of the things people do here to congregate.” “I was sure that I’d met him a long time ago, but he didn’t think that we had,” she said. The two didn’t exchange numbers that night, but ran into each other again nearly a year later. The rest, as she put it, is history.

She also opened up about planning their pregnancy. “One day we looked at each other and said, ‘Well, this is as ready as we’re going to be.'” Pattinson made her a rap playlist for the birth. “He was there with me and like all dads, he was really nervous, but for someone who’s quite an anxious person, he’s been very calm,” she said. “He’s the dad I could have hoped for. I mean a dad and his daughter? It’s an actual love story.”

May 2025: A Different Kind of Energy

At Cannes, promoting Die, My Love, Pattinson made a rare comment about fatherhood on the red carpet. “I think, in the most unexpected ways, having a baby gives you the biggest trove of energy and inspiration afterward. It’s a different kind of energy.”

November 2025: A Rare Red Carpet Together

Waterhouse joined Pattinson at the New York premiere of Die My Love on November 1, one of the few public appearances the two have made together since becoming parents.

January 2026: Not the Biggest Fan of Kids, Until He Was

In a GQ interview, Pattinson admitted that before fatherhood, “I wasn’t the biggest fan of kids. I didn’t mind them. I would tolerate them.” Now, he says, being with his daughter is “the most fun thing. I think it’s absolutely wonderful.” He also described the physical toll of being away from her. “Even if you’re on the other side of the planet, you’re like, ‘Okay, I cannot spend more than 10 days away.’ After 10 days of being away, it’s physical pain. It’s so interesting, your body chemistry changes without you even thinking about it.” 

March 2026: A Night at Vanity Fair

The couple attended the 2026 Vanity Fair Oscars after-party on March 15, Waterhouse in an ivory Tamara Ralph gown with an ornate gold bodice and sheer cape, Pattinson keeping it classic in a black Dior tuxedo.

May 2026: Talk of a Bigger Family

In a Variety interview, Waterhouse hinted that she and Pattinson are open to more children down the line. “I feel like I’m in it for the long run,” she said. “I just want to keep creating, really, and maybe have a larger family, like max two more kids. That would be cool.”

July 2026: A Song Called "Weirdo"

Waterhouse told Rolling Stone that her new song “Weirdo” was inspired by Pattinson, touching on the difficulty of balancing two demanding careers and the distance that comes with it.

Later that month, on the And the Writer Is… podcast, she gave a glimpse into family life, revealing their daughter has fully embraced Pattinson’s latest role. “She calls him ‘Daddy Batman’ now because he’s always dressed up like that now for the next seven months whenever he’s on FaceTime.”
